How You Can Restore Exchange Server Data to Exchange Server Systems

The following table describes the source objects that you can select, and their supported destinations, when restoring Exchange Server 2003, 2007, 2010, or 2013. data to Exchange Server 2003, 2007, 2010, or 2013 systems using the Arcserve Backup Agent for Microsoft Exchange:

When destination is Exchange Server 2003 or 2007

Source Objects

Supported Destinations

Storage Group

Microsoft Exchange Server - Document Level

Public Folders [Storage Group]

Microsoft Exchange Server - Document Level

Mailbox Store

Storage Group

Mailbox*

Public Folders, [Storage Group], Mailbox Store, Mailbox, Folder

Folder

Public Folders [Storage Group], Mailbox, Folder

Document

Folder

When destination is Exchange Server 2010/2013

Source Objects

Supported Destinations

Database

Microsoft Exchange Server - Document Level

Public Folders

Microsoft Exchange Server - Document Level

Mailbox*

Public Folders, Mailbox Store, Mailbox, Folder

Folder

Public Folders, Mailbox, Folder

Document

Folder

*Mailbox is converted into a folder if it is not restored to a Mailbox Store.
